Core 2 Quad Q8200 hits stores on Aug 31

By: (more) | Posted: Jul 28, 2008 9:02 pm

The word's just been given that Intel's next Core 2 Quad, the Q8200 is set to arrive on August 31. Specs wise, it runs a lower clockspeed than the good ole' Q6600 at just 2.33GHz, yet will be priced higher. It should still attract some attention, though, as it runs newer Penryn cores with 4MB of L2 cache each.

 


We've nabbed a fair amount of information about Intel's Core 2 Quad Q8200 over the past few weeks. According to fairly recent rumors, the forthcoming processor will feature four 45nm cores clocked at 2.33GHz, 4MB of L2 cache, a 1333MHz front-side bus, and a price tag of just $203-about $10 more than what the 65nm, 2.4GHz Core 2 Quad Q6600 now costs.

 

As with most early rumors about unreleased CPUs, nobody said exactly when the chip might arrive. Fudzilla filled in that blank earlier this morning by saying Intel will introduce the Q8200 on August 31. Fudzilla's news blurb quotes the same specs we just noted, but it mentions a $224 wholesale price tag.
